Lot Grading in Houston, TX

Lot grading services involve shaping and leveling the land around a property to ensure proper drainage and stability. This process is often requested for projects such as preparing a yard for landscaping, installing new driveways, building foundations, or ensuring water flows away from the home to prevent flooding and water damage. Homeowners considering lot grading should understand how the existing terrain impacts water runoff and drainage, and they may want to know about the best grading techniques to achieve a slope that directs water away from structures.

Before requesting lot grading, property owners typically want to assess the current land contour and determine the ideal grade for their specific project. It is important to consider factors such as soil type, existing landscaping, and local drainage patterns. Clear communication about the desired outcome, including the direction of water flow and the level of elevation needed, can help ensure the grading work effectively protects the property and enhances its overall stability.

Lot Grading Questions

What is lot grading? Lot grading involves shaping and leveling the land around a property to ensure proper drainage and prevent water accumulation.

Why is lot grading important? Proper lot grading helps protect foundations, reduce erosion, and improve water flow away from structures.

What types of projects require lot grading? Projects such as new construction, landscape improvements, or drainage repairs often need lot grading services.

How can I tell if my lot needs grading? Signs include standing water after rain, uneven ground, or water pooling near the foundation.
